The Moon in a 90 degree angle to Uranus reflects dissociated emotions and an impersonal, cool and unemotional demeanor.

> edit this In the personality

This is an intensely restless aspect, reflecting an individual who has a hard time staying in one place for long. It does not take well to demands, and has a strong independent streak.

It often reflects early emotional conflicts, and these natives have been treated in a cold manner, perhaps objectified to some degree, and so have learned to dissociate from their emotions so that they are not too sensitive or touchy. As a result they can be difficult to get close to, as they have strong defenses. The negativity of the background seem to be lessened by a 5th house location of the moon, although there is still harsh, cold energies around the child.

On the positive side, this aspect strengthen the personality and allows the person to act without too much interference from his emotions. This aspect usually adds boldness in the character. On the negative side, this aspect can make the person emotionally icy and calculated.

They may have issues with having children in that they don't want to lose their freedom.

The moon's house position is important to get an idea as to how these energies will seek expression.
